| Hexagonal Boron Nitride |
| Molecular formula: |
BN |
molecular weight: |
24.82 | |
| Properties: |
It is a kind of white loose powder. The properties are similar to those of graphite. It has excellent electric insulativity, thermal conductivity and chemical resistance. |
| Characteristics |
high crystallinity,low index of graphitization, high purity, even particle size distribution, can be used as additive of high temperature solid lubricant, cubic boron nitride and special materials.

| Fields of application: |
 |
high temperature solid lubricant and many kinds of parting agent of precision molding products. | |
 |
High temperature resistant, anticorrosive boron nitride and boron nitride compound ceramics | |
 |
synthesize cubic boron nitride | |
 |
compression resistant and high temperature resistant lubricating grease | |
 |
all kinds of high temperature resistant, anticorrosion coating | |
 |
insulator for high pressure high frequency electricity and plasma arc. | |
 |
oxidating additive for refractory materials | |
